What Does Business Class from Philadelphia to Sarajevo Cost?
Business class from Philadelphia to Sarajevo is one of the more underserved transatlantic routes in premium travel, yet CEOFLIGHTS secures round-trip fares as low as $2,200 — a figure that can run closer to $5,500 when booked through conventional public channels during peak periods.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) connects North American travelers to Sarajevo International Airport (SJJ) via major hub connections, and the difference between paying retail and paying a private insider rate often comes down to who is making the call on your behalf.
The three primary carriers operating connecting itineraries on this corridor are Delta Air Lines, United Airlines, and American Airlines, each routing through their respective European hub partners before arriving at SJJ. Total travel time from PHL to Sarajevo typically runs around nine hours of flight time, with layover variables depending on the routing chosen. The best months to find value on this route are January, February, March, October, and November. Sarajevo has emerged as a serious destination for business travelers working across the Western Balkans, with the city serving as a growing hub for finance, energy, and international development sectors.
